logo

Output 42180496e935420a3f7b057330ad90938c930b55ae33d209ae2d2828acba18e1:0

value
349678
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ba8e952783bd7bba0be60e01e942bbe1a8d3e33 OP_EQUALVERIFY OP_CHECKSIG
address
17u42ZNWnWhiVJEY9E95A7xCzZBEieujHo
transaction
42180496e935420a3f7b057330ad90938c930b55ae33d209ae2d2828acba18e1